01 Definition

Pulitzer Prize-winning Pentagon correspondent for The New York Times who co-authored the 2017 exposé on DoD anomalous aerospace research programs.

02 Detailed_Analysis

Helene Cooper is a senior defense correspondent for The New York Times based at the Pentagon. In December 2017, she co-authored the landmark front-page article disclosing the Defense Intelligence Agency's and Office of the Under Secretary of Defense for Intelligence's involvement in AATIP/AAWSAP. Her reporting provided verified institutional sourcing and access to high-level defense officials, establishing national security credibility for the topic.

03 Key_Facts

  • Pentagon correspondent for The New York Times and Pulitzer Prize winner
  • Co-authored the December 16, 2017 front-page article on secret Pentagon UAP efforts
  • Reported on formal military pilot reporting protocols and safety hazards
